NEW AIR ROUTE TO HONG KONG

IMPERIAL AIRWAYS SERVICE IN OPERATION

LONDON, December 19,

London will be brought within eight and a half days of Hong Kong after to-morrow, when the new Imperial Airways route will be opened between Hong Kong and Bangkok.

The new air line will be a branch of the main England-Australia air route, connecting with the latter at Bangkok. It is 400 miles shorter than the former Imperial Airways line to Hong Kong via Penang. The service will be maintained by liners of the Diana class.
